After several days of hot and muggy weather, we woke up to a cool Morning; in fact a little chilly. It was over ninety, yesterday. I think it reached 97F. About five o'clock, last evening, it was 93F, when a thunderstorm rolled in. It dropped an inch of rain, and the temperature went to 68F. Overnight, the temperature dropped to 51F. A 42 degree drop in temperature in twelve hours. That's Minnesota.

The rain didn't hurt the mosquitoes. We did get a repellant, from the Amish, that works quite well. It is citronella based and has other herbal ingredients. You have to cover yourself, quite completely, to get the benefit. Miss a spot and the mosquitoes are there.
